Output 893efeec28c9ddf5d460dbbc8a9d4dc260445650dea37f144140a6d4d77aa84a:1

value
14359196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006b2ad39af49ead730f48eab19dd56653f02e70 OP_EQUAL
address
31jEJf6juJSmregoKMmenbUv4uqjYoVgFy
transaction
893efeec28c9ddf5d460dbbc8a9d4dc260445650dea37f144140a6d4d77aa84a
confirmations
382813
spent
true